Simultaneously, the episode cuts to Asim’s office. His young intern, Zoya, has been blackmailing him over their one-night stand. Episode 7 reveals that Zoya is not just a random girl—she is the daughter of Asim’s business rival. This twist elevates the series from a simple affair drama to a corporate revenge thriller.
